Type: 9.6 km NW of New Springs, Western Australia, 19.ix.1979, R.J. Chinnock 4730 (holotype: AD; isotypes: CANB, K, MEL, MO, NSW, PERTH).
-
Etymology: "Latin diffusa, diffuse, loosely or widely spreading; referring to the habit."
